//! # Factory actors
//!
//! A factory is a manager of a pool of workers on the same node. This
//! is helpful for job dispatch and load balancing when single-threaded execution
//! of a since [crate::Actor] may not be sufficient. Factories have a set "Job" syntax
//! which denotes a key and message payload for each action. Workers are effectively mindless
//! agents of the factory's will.
//!
//! ## Worker message routing mode
//!
//! The factory has a series of dispatch modes which are defined in [RoutingMode] and
//! control the way the factory dispatches work to workers. This should be selected based
//! on the intended workload. Some general guidance:
//!
//! 1. If you need to process a sequence of operations on a given key (i.e. the Job is a user, and
//! there's a sequential list of updates to that user). You then want the job to land on the same
//! worker and should select [RoutingMode::KeyPersistent] or [RoutingMode::StickyQueuer].
//! 2. If you don't need a sequence of operations then [RoutingMode::Queuer] is likely a good choice.
//! 3. If your workers are making remote calls to other services/actors you probably want [RoutingMode::Queuer]
//! or [RoutingMode::StickyQueuer] to prevent head-of-the-line contention. Otherwise [RoutingMode::KeyPersistent]
//! is sufficient.
//! 4. For some custom defined routing, you can define your own [CustomHashFunction] which will be
//! used in conjunction with [RoutingMode::CustomHashFunction] to take the incoming job key and
//! the space which should be hashed to (i.e. the number of workers).
//! 5. If you just want load balancing there's also [RoutingMode::RoundRobin] and [RoutingMode::Random]
//! for general 1-off dispatching of jobs
//!
//! ## Worker lifecycle
//!
//! A worker's lifecycle is managed by the factory. If the worker dies or crashes, the factory will
//! replace the worker with a new instance and continue processing jobs for that worker. The
//! factory also maintains the worker's message queue's so messages won't be lost which were in the
//! "worker"'s queue.
